Overview

Wright stain is a compound dye composed of the acidic dye Eosin and the basic dye Methylene Blue, which delivers excellent differential staining of protoplasm. Giemsa stain is a mixture of Azure II and Eosin. Its staining principle and resultant coloration are basically consistent with Wright staining. Giemsa stain exhibits strong affinity for cytoplasm and clearly reveals the basophilic degree of cytoplasm. In particular, it distinctly stains azurophilic, eosinophilic and basophilic granules in blood and bone marrow cells. However, it overstains cell nuclei and fails to display fine nuclear structures clearly. For this reason, Giemsa stain is frequently used in combination with Wright stain.

Wright-Giemsa Staining Kit is formulated with high-quality Wright and Giemsa dyes as the primary raw materials, yielding sharp and clear cellular staining results. It is widely applied for staining blood smears, cell smears, bone marrow smears and bacteria. Cytoplasm stains red; cell nuclei and bacteria appear blue; eosinophilic granules turn orange-red. Neutral glycerol is added to the staining solution to inhibit methanol volatilization and oxidation, while also sharpening the staining morphology of blood cells. Features of this stain: The kit consists of Wright-Giemsa combined staining solution and phosphate buffer. The two components can be mixed in equal volumes for use, or applied to specimens separately.

Instructions for Use:

1. Prepare blood smears, bone marrow smears or bacterial smears via standard protocols and allow the smears to air-dry naturally.

2. Place the blood or bone marrow smears on a staining rack.

3. Add an appropriate amount of Wright-Giemsa staining solution to fully cover the smear, and stain at room temperature for 1–2 minutes.

4. Add an equal volume of phosphate buffer solution to the smear. Gently rock the slide or mix by other means to fully blend the buffer with the Wright-Giemsa staining solution, then incubate at room temperature for 3–10 minutes.

5. Alternative procedure for Steps 3 and 4: Mix equal volumes of Wright-Giemsa staining solution and phosphate buffer to prepare Wright-Giemsa working solution. Apply the working solution to blood or bone marrow smears and incubate at room temperature for 3–10 minutes.

6. Gently rinse the slide from one end with tap water or distilled water. (Note: The slide can also be rinsed with phosphate buffer diluted at an equal ratio for approximately 30 seconds.)

7. Air-dry the slide. Microscopic examination: Observe the blood smear under low magnification first, then switch to oil immersion objective.

Precautions:

1. Blood and bone marrow smears must be uniformly thick to avoid uneven staining results.

2. Do not pour off the staining solution in advance or flush the smear with strong water flow during staining. Premature draining of the stain will cause dye precipitate to deposit on the smear.

3. The staining solution may be reused a limited number of times. Filter the solution to remove precipitates before reusing.

4. Over-stained slides can be appropriately decolorized with methanol or ethanol; re-staining is not recommended.

5. Adjust the staining duration or working solution concentration if staining appears too dark or too pale.

6. Wear a lab coat and disposable gloves during all operations for personal safety and health protection.
